Anton Dominikus Biber (born July 29, 1797 in Ellingen , † April 6, 1863 in Nuremberg ) was a German piano maker. He is a member of the German piano making family "Biber".
life and work
Anton Dominikus Biber learned the craft of piano maker from his father Andreas Clemens Biber . Later he trained his brother Aloys Aegydius Biber to be a piano maker. After further years of training in Vienna and Munich, he founded his own piano workshop in Fürth. He moved this to Nuremberg in 1824.
Biber's instruments were widely recognized at the industrial exhibitions in Munich in 1835 and 1840. Some of them were exported overseas, for example to New Orleans .
